Pelvic Floor Rehabilitation
Pelvic floor rehabilitation is a term that describes a systematic approach to improving the strength and function of the muscles that support the bladder, urethra and other organs contained within the bony pelvis. (Treatment for pelvic floor pain, dysfunction, and/or incontinence)
